Description

Situated on the popular Fife Road in Herne Bay, this well presented two-bedroom semi-detached bungalow offers spacious and versatile accommodation, generous off-road parking and excellent potential for those looking for comfortable single-level living.

The property provides approximately 934 sq. ft. of accommodation and has been thoughtfully arranged to offer a particularly good sense of space. At the heart of the home is a bright and welcoming 13'7 x 13'7 lounge, which leads through to a useful sun room, creating an additional reception space that could be used for relaxing, dining or as a hobby area.

The kitchen is well positioned and offers a practical range of wall and base units, while the accommodation is completed by two well-proportioned bedrooms and a shower wet room. The property also benefits from a useful entrance hall providing access to the principal rooms.

One of the standout features is the exceptionally generous block-paved frontage, providing extensive off-road parking and making the property particularly practical for those with multiple vehicles or visiting family and friends. The home also benefits from solar panels, offering the potential to improve energy efficiency and reduce reliance on mains electricity. The owners have also rewired the home as part of the schedule of refurbishment.

To the side/rear of the property is a substantial separate storage building, providing excellent additional space for garden equipment, hobbies, workshop use or general storage, a valuable feature rarely found with bungalows of this type. The garden is a generous size and is mostly laid to lawn, leaving a blank canvas for the new owners to enjoy.

Fife Road is a popular residential location within Herne Bay, providing convenient access to local amenities and the wider town, while the seafront, shops, cafes and transport links are all within easy reach.

In summary, this is a spacious and versatile two-bedroom bungalow with approximately 934 sq. ft. of accommodation, extensive off-road parking, solar panels, a useful sun room and substantial additional storage, an excellent opportunity for those seeking comfortable single-storey living in a popular Herne Bay location.

Location Summary

Herne Bay is a popular coastal town benefiting from a range of local amenities including retail outlets and educational facilities. There are also a good range of leisure amenities including rowing, sailing and yacht clubs along with a swimming pool, theatre and cinema. The mainline railway station (approximately 1 mile distant) offers fast and frequent links to London (Victoria approximately 85mins) as well as the high speed service to London (St Pancras approximately 87mins). The town also offers excellent access to the A299 which gives access to the A2/ M2 motorway network. The picturesque town of Whitstable is only 5 miles distant which also enjoys a variety of shopping, educational and leisure amenities including sailing, water sports and bird watching, as well as the seafood restaurants for which it has become renowned. The City of Canterbury is approximately eight miles distant with its Cathedral, theatre and cultural amenities, as well as benefiting from excellent public and state schools. The City also boasts the facilities of a major shopping centre enjoying a range of mainstream retail outlets as well as many individual shops.
